Ouya Gets OnLive Support, Reveals Controller

Crowdfunded console Ouya has gotten its latest update posted to its Kickstarter page, revealing that cloud gaming service OnLive will be partnering with the future system when it launches early next year.



OnLive’s General Manager Bruce Grove says that his company is “pleased to deliver the same OnLive experience on the OUYA console when it launches next year,” which would suggest that Ouya owners will be getting the same service, and presumably the same available library of titles that PC, smartphone, tablet, and OnLive Game System owners have at their disposal today.

Along with the news of the new partnership, we’ve also been given the first public showing of the full Ouya controller. The update notes that the design is still a work-in-progress, but this marks the first time anyone has seen more than just the right half of it.



Ouya is still scheduled for launch in early 2013. Its Kickstarter, which has now gained almost 44,000 backers and over $5.6 million in pledged money, has 12 days left to go.
